Intersectional Gender Equality Working Group Fosters Inclusive Sexology at RSU
During the 2025/2026 academic year, the Intersectional Gender Equality Working Group, established within the framework of the INCLUDE project, carried out an active collaboration with the RSU Sexology Student Interest Group (pictured).

Within this framework, INCLUDE researcher and RSU lecturer Diāna Kiščenko served as a mentor, while researcher Jana Kukaine was invited as an expert and guest lecturer. This synergy provided the necessary theoretical foundation and practical support for the interdisciplinary study of sexuality, health, and society, integrating an intersectional perspective into the research interests of future specialists and promoting an understanding of the interplay between various social categories.
Throughout the year, in theoretical and practical sessions as well as educational events, topics of sexuality and sexology were addressed as an essential and multidimensional part of health and society. A comprehensive understanding of these issues was fostered through interdisciplinary dialogue, combining perspectives from medical, social, and human sciences. This approach allowed students to analyze these subjects not only from a medical standpoint but also through the lens of social factors, highlighting how sex, gender, age, ethnicity, and health status impact individuals’ experiences within the healthcare system and society at large.
These activities directly contribute to the broader goal of the INCLUDE project to improve gender equality and foster a diversity-based inclusive environment in biomedical research and higher education. The collaboration between the Sexology Interest Group and INCLUDE researchers clearly demonstrates that institutional change and the creation of a safe environment require a continuous interdisciplinary dialogue, while simultaneously making a practical contribution to the education of future specialists and public awareness.
